The first thing i wanted to tell you about is the packaging and what a good idea i think these palettes are. Each shadow has a number from one to four to where to place the shadow to create the perfect smokey eye Each of the shadows are really nice on there own or on a natural day. The palette comes with a double ended sponge brush. It also has a nice mirror in the lid of the palette and the outer container is sleek black with the brand name carved into the packaging.

All the shadows are super pigmented and beautiful to blend. Most if not all the shadows can be worn in any order not just in order of the numbers but all on their own as well, i wear a lot of these shadows on their own or with shadows from my Makeup Revolution Palette which go really nicely with all of the colours. 

The brush that comes with the Quads isn't grate quality i hate using sponges to apply shadows that is my own personal opinion. 

The shadows that are grey and black are '07005 Urban Skyline'

The shadows that are more red tones are '04562 Metal Eyes'
The shadows that are more pink/nude are' 05488 Berry Love'

All the palettes are £5.50 each which for the shadows is really good and perfect for little Christmas presents to moved ones.

They do tend to crease if you don't use a good primer, but that does happen with most shadows that claim to be crease proof.
